KDJ金叉指标公式源码全解析:从原理到实战,避开这3个坑才能稳定盈利
很多散户朋友看到KDJ金叉就兴奋,觉得是买入信号,结果一买就套,一卖就涨。其实,KDJ金叉指标公式源码并不神秘,关键在于你懂不懂它背后的逻辑。今天我就把KDJ金叉的底层代码原理、实战用法和常见误区一次性说清楚,让你不再被这个指标牵着鼻子走。
一、KDJ金叉是什么?一句话概括
KDJ金叉,就是当K线(快线)从下方向上穿过D线(慢线),形成的一个“交叉点”。通常出现在股价低位或上涨途中,被不少技术派视为买入参考信号。但这个信号的有效性,取决于你用的参数和当前市场环境。
二、KDJ金叉指标公式源码(通达信/同花顺通用)
很多朋友可能只会在软件里点“KDJ金叉”选股,但不知道它背后是怎么算的。下面我贴出最常用的9,3,3参数下的公式源码:
RSV:=(CLOSE-LLV(LOW,N))/(HHV(HIGH,N)-LLV(LOW,N))*100;
K:SMA(RSV,M1,1);
D:SMA(K,M2,1);
J:3*K-2*D;
金叉:CROSS(K,D);
其中N=9,M1=3,M2=3。这个公式里,RSV(未成熟随机值)衡量的是当前收盘价在最近9天最高最低价区间内的位置,然后通过两次平滑得到K和D。金叉就是K线上穿D线的那一瞬间。
三、原理拆解:为什么金叉会涨?
KDJ的本质是“超买超卖”指标。当股价下跌时,RSV会变小,K和D跟着下滑。一旦股价止跌回升,K线会快速反应,率先拐头,而D线反应慢,于是形成金叉。这个交叉点,本质上反映的是短期动能由弱转强。很多散户看到金叉就冲进去,但忽略了:金叉的位置和角度远比金叉本身重要。
四、实战用法:怎么用KDJ金叉赚钱?
- 低位金叉(20以下)更可信:当K、D值都低于20,股价经过充分下跌后出现的金叉,往往代表超跌反弹机会。如果伴随成交量放大,成功率更高。
- 上升趋势中的回档金叉:股价沿着20日均线上行,KDJ从高位死叉回落到50附近再度金叉,这是主力洗盘结束的信号,可以大胆加仓。
- 结合MACD或均线过滤:单独KDJ金叉容易假信号。比如,如果股价处于60日均线下方,KDJ金叉只能当短线反弹做,快进快出;如果股价在均线上方,金叉里又多了一份趋势的支撑。
简化理解: 把KDJ金叉想象成一个“短跑运动员的起跑姿势”。在泥泞地(熊市)里起跑很容易摔倒,只有在赛道上(上升趋势)起跑才有意义。
五、常见误区(90%的散户都踩过)
- 误区一:金叉就买,死叉就卖。这是最典型的韭菜思维。KDJ金叉在震荡市中经常失效,甚至出现“金叉越金叉越跌”的情况,因为指标会钝化。正确做法是先判断大趋势,再结合金叉信号。
- 误区二:参数越小越灵敏越好。很多新手把N改成5,觉得能抓涨停。结果金叉次数大增,假信号也多得离谱。建议新手就用默认(9,3,3),等实战经验丰富了再调。
- 误区三:只看金叉,不看背离。当股价创新低,但KDJ金叉的低点却抬高,这叫底背离,是真正的抄底机会;反之,股价创新高但KDJ金叉高点降低,是顶背离,赶紧跑。
投资者常见心理: 很多散户在连续阴跌中盯着KDJ,盼着金叉救命。等到金叉真的出现,反而因为被套太久犹豫不决,错过最佳买点;或者一看见金叉就满仓冲进去,结果遇到假突破。记住:KDJ金叉不是万能钥匙,它只是帮你判断短期情绪的工具。
六、总结建议
KDJ金叉指标公式源码就这么多,但能不能赚钱,取决于你的交易系统。如果你只是按金叉买、死叉卖,多半会亏。建议:
1. 把KDJ金叉作为辅助信号,配合均线、成交量使用。
2. 在周线级别看趋势,日线级别找金叉买点。
3. 严格设置止损,比如金叉买入后跌破最近一根大阳线的最低点就离场。
一句话总结: KDJ金叉是“短线情绪温度计”,不是“提款机说明书”。用好它,前提是你得先学会看天气(大盘和板块趋势)。
适合什么人使用? 短线交易者、超跌反弹爱好者、以及刚入门想学习指标的散户。建议先模拟盘练习100次金叉操作,再实盘。
【知识延伸】
Q:KDJ金叉和死叉哪个更有效?
A:在震荡市中,金叉和死叉有效性都不高,容易频繁亏损。在单边趋势中,金叉在上升趋势中有效,死叉在下降趋势中有效。逆势使用会死得很惨。
Q:KDJ参数改成(5,3,3)有什么影响?
A:灵敏度提高,金叉死叉切换更快,适合超短线(T+0或隔日),但假信号更多。建议搭配量能变化和分时图主力挂单来辅助判断。
Q:为什么有时KDJ金叉了股价反而跌?
A:可能是主力故意拉升指标吸引跟风盘,然后反向出货。或者大盘突然跳水。记住:任何技术指标都有滞后性,KDJ金叉只是过去5秒的价格结果,不代表未来。